Update 12.5.07

James performed an intimate acoustic set as a four-piece (minus Dave and Saul) to 20 competition winners and guests of Key 103 at Manchester Hilton Hotel's Cloud 23 Bar yesterday evening.  The set included Just Like Fred Astaire, Chain Mail, Who Are You, Really Hard, Upside Downside, She's a Star, Out To Get You, Laid, Top Of The World and Sit Down.  The show was recorded and should be broadcast and available on Key 103's website some point next week.

Update 1.5.07

To celebrate the release of Fresh As A Daisy - The Singles, James played two shows in Manchester last night.

At a 5pm show in Market Street HMV, they played a short set featuring Out To Get You, Really Hard, Chain Mail, Just Like Fred Astaire, She's A Star and Laid.  For a review click here.

This was followed by a rather unique and unusual set, devoid of most of their major hit singles, to 400 competition winners and guests at Manchester's Club Academy, where Tim first met Jim way back in 1981.   The set featured Seven, Heavens, Chain Mail, Riders, Don't Wait That Long, Really Hard, Top Of The World, Stripmining, If Things Were Perfect, Fine, 5-0, Chameleon, Upside Downside, Getting Away With It (All Messed Up), Out To Get You and Laid.  For a review click here.

First day reports from Manchester HMV suggest that the store alone sold over 1,000 copies of the cd and dvd versions of Fresh As A Daisy, making it their best first day sales of the year so far.
